Caring for an Acne-Prone Skin: A Simple Guide

caring-for-an-acne-prone-skin-a-simple-guide

An acne-prone skin is a common problem among teens and adults. You may have tried several products before, but not getting the results you expect can be frustrating. If you need some serious self-care tips to help you manage your acne, especially if you’re getting treatment, check out these tips below.

  • Keep your skin clean.

    It’s essential to wash your face twice a day. Find a gentle and non-abrasive cleanser to avoid irritation and harmful chemical interactions. Does your dermatologist in Texas give you specific instructions when washing your face? Make sure to follow it for the best results!

  • Choose the proper products/treatment.

    An acne-prone skin requires gentle skin care products, especially alcohol-free. As much as possible, avoid those that can irritate your skin, such as astringents, toners, and exfoliants. They may dry your skin and make your acne look worse. Choose gentle cosmetic products, too!

  • Avoid touching your face.

    Touching your face can be so tempting! But remember that it can cause acne to flare. Don’t pick, squeeze, or pop your acne to reduce your risk for scarring and dark spots.
